Introduction to Emergency Shelters and the Need for Prefab Solutions


In times of natural disasters, humanitarian crises, or unforeseen emergencies, the immediate need for reliable shelter cannot be overstated. Traditional emergency response shelters often face significant challenges such as speed of deployment, cost, and sustainability. In recent years, **prefabricated (prefab) shelters** have emerged as a viable solution, offering a range of benefits that address these challenges.
This article explores the future of emergency shelters by examining the various prefab options available, their advantages, and how they are reshaping the landscape of disaster response.

The Evolution of Emergency Shelters


A Brief History of Emergency Shelters


The concept of emergency shelters has evolved significantly over the decades. Initially, shelters were constructed using temporary materials and designed to provide immediate, albeit basic, protection. Over time, advancements in **building technology** and **materials science** have allowed for more durable, safe, and efficient shelter options.

The Rise of Prefabricated Structures


In the 21st century, prefab structures have gained popularity. These buildings are manufactured off-site and can be quickly assembled in emergency locations, drastically reducing setup time. As the world continues to face increasing natural disasters due to climate change, the demand for effective emergency shelters has never been higher.

Understanding Prefab Emergency Shelters


What are Prefab Emergency Shelters?


**Prefab emergency shelters** are modular structures that are pre-manufactured in controlled factory environments. They typically consist of panels or units that are designed for rapid assembly and disassembly. This design allows for **portability** and **flexibility**, making them ideal for emergency situations.

Types of Prefab Emergency Shelters


There are several types of prefab emergency shelters, each catering to different needs:
1. **Container Homes**: Shipping containers converted into livable spaces can provide robust emergency housing.
2. **Modular Units**: These are pre-constructed sections that can be easily connected to form larger structures.
3. **Inflatable Shelters**: Quick to deploy, these shelters are made from durable materials and can be inflated to provide immediate protection.
4. **Eco-friendly Units**: Sustainable shelters designed using renewable materials, offering environmentally conscious solutions.

Advantages of Using Prefab Emergency Shelters


Quick Deployment and Assembly


One of the most significant advantages of prefab emergency shelters is their ability to be deployed and assembled quickly. In disaster scenarios where time is of the essence, the speed at which these shelters can be set up makes a substantial difference in providing immediate assistance to those in need.

Cost-Effectiveness


Prefab shelters can be more cost-effective than traditional building methods. Reduced labor costs, lower material waste, and the ability to mass-produce units contribute to overall savings. This economic efficiency allows organizations and governments to allocate funds to other critical areas during emergencies.

High Durability and Safety Standards


Modern prefab structures are engineered to meet and exceed safety standards. With the use of advanced materials and construction methods, these shelters can withstand harsh weather conditions, ensuring the safety of occupants during natural disasters.

Flexibility in Design and Customization


Prefab emergency shelters can be customized to suit various needs, including family size, medical facilities, and communal spaces. This flexibility ensures that shelters can be tailored to accommodate specific community requirements during a crisis.

Environmental Sustainability


Many prefab options utilize sustainable materials and energy-efficient designs. This focus on eco-friendliness not only minimizes environmental impact but also promotes resilience in communities by fostering sustainable practices.

Case Studies: Successful Implementations of Prefab Emergency Shelters


Hurricane Katrina: A Turning Point


In the aftermath of Hurricane Katrina in 2005, the need for rapid shelter solutions became painfully evident. Organizations turned to prefab shelters as a quick response option. Units were deployed across affected areas, providing families with safe housing while permanent solutions were developed.

The Response to the Syrian Refugee Crisis


The Syrian refugee crisis highlighted the necessity for immediate shelter solutions. Organizations like the UNHCR implemented prefab units that could be quickly set up in refugee camps. These shelters provided adequate living conditions for thousands, showcasing the effectiveness and scalability of prefab designs.

Challenges and Limitations of Prefab Emergency Shelters


While prefab emergency shelters offer numerous benefits, they are not without challenges.

Public Perception and Acceptance


One of the main hurdles is the public perception of prefab structures as temporary or inferior. Overcoming this stigma requires education and awareness campaigns to inform communities about the quality and durability of modern prefab designs.

Logistical Challenges in Deployment


Transporting and assembling prefab shelters in remote or disaster-stricken areas can present logistical challenges. Ensuring that the necessary resources and personnel are available for deployment is crucial for effective emergency responses.

Regulatory Hurdles and Building Codes


Local building codes and regulations can impact the deployment of prefab shelters. Navigating these legal landscapes requires careful planning and coordination with local authorities to ensure compliance and facilitate rapid setup.

Future Trends in Prefab Emergency Shelters


Integration of Smart Technology


As technology advances, the integration of smart features in prefab shelters is becoming a reality. Innovations such as solar energy systems, smart home technology, and water purification units can enhance the functionality and livability of these structures.

Sustainable Practices and Materials


The future of prefab emergency shelters will likely see an increase in the use of sustainable materials and construction practices. Eco-friendly designs will not only reduce environmental impact but will also promote resilience within communities.

Community-Centric Designs


The shift towards community-centric designs emphasizes the importance of creating spaces that foster connection and support among inhabitants. Future prefab shelters will likely focus on building communal areas that encourage social interaction and collaboration during crises.
